2. How It Works – A Rapid‑Fire Guide

Before you launch Chicken Road, you’ll set a stake and pick a difficulty – Easy, Medium, Hard, or Hardcore – each altering the number of steps and the risk of traps. The chicken begins its journey on step one; after each successful hop the multiplier rises.

At any point you can tap “Cash Out” and secure your winnings at that multiplier, or let the chicken continue for potentially higher rewards.

If a hidden trap appears – a manhole cover or an oven – the round ends abruptly and you lose everything for that bet.

Because you control every step, the game feels less like passive waiting and more like active pacing, giving you agency over your fate.

4. Difficulty Levels – Picking Your Risk Profile

The four difficulty settings modify how many steps you need to cross before hitting the final golden egg:

  1. Easy – 24 steps; lower multipliers but fewer traps.
  2. Medium – 22 steps; balanced risk and reward.
  3. Hard – 20 steps; higher multipliers with more traps.
  4. Hardcore – 15 steps; maximum risk and potential for huge wins.

Short‑session players often gravitate toward Easy or Medium because they offer frequent opportunities to cash out early without getting stuck for too long.
